Say NO to Bad Power Banks: The Ultimate Red Flags List
Power banks are lifesavers when your phone dies, but choosing a bad one can be as disastrous This is a scam power bank as getting stuck with a dead battery. Luckily, there are obvious indicators to help you avoid those power bank failures.
- A price that's can often indicate a cheaply made product.
- Pay attention to reviews from other users – they can give you valuable clues about the power bank's performance.
- Avoid brands that you don't recognize unless they have strong reviews from reputable sources.
- Double-check the power bank has a included safety circuit to protect your devices from overcharging and damage.
- Trusted power bank should charge your devices quickly and powerfully.
